Company Registration in Brazil: Procedure & Benefits

This guide provides comprehensive information on company registration in Brazil, including the advantages, fees, requirements, and paperwork needed.

Grow Your Business
Internationally






Table of Contents

company registration in brazil

Brazil is strategically located between North America and South America, making it a natural hub for trade and investment in the region. With a population of over 214 million (as of 2025) and a Gross National Income (GNI) per capita of USD 9,140 (2023 est.), Brazil presents vast business opportunities for entrepreneurs and investors.

The Brazilian government has actively signed numerous free trade agreements, including those with the EU, Mercosur, and China, providing enhanced access to international markets. Additionally, it has implemented policies aimed at promoting foreign investment through tax incentives and streamlined registration processes.

In this article, we will discuss the detailed process of company registration in Brazil, the required documents, various business entity types, tax obligations, estimated costs, and the advantages of incorporating a company in Brazil.

Eligibility for Brazil Company Registration

To register a company in Brazil, certain basic legal and structural requirements must be met:

  • The company name must be unique and not previously registered.
  • Shareholders and directors must be legally capable of entering into contracts.
  • A minimum share capital applies depending on the entity type (e.g., R$100.00 for an LTDA).
  • Depending on the business activity, additional licenses or permits may be required.
  • registered office address in Brazil is mandatory.
  • All documents (like Articles of Incorporation) must be in Portuguese and in compliance with Brazilian law.
  • The business must comply with Brazilian tax and accounting regulations.

Procedure for Company Registration in Brazil

The following steps outline how to open a company in Brazil:

Step 1: Choose a Company Name

Ensure the company name is available and not in use by another entity. It should follow naming conventions established by Brazilian regulations.

Step 2: Obtain a CNPJ Number

Apply for a CNPJ (Cadastro Nacional da Pessoa Jurídica) from the Brazilian Federal Revenue Service. This serves as the business tax ID.

Step 3: Register the Articles of Incorporation

Submit the Articles of Incorporation to the Commercial Board of the state where the company will be located, and with the Federal Revenue Service.

Step 4: Obtain a Business License

Apply at the municipal government office where your business is headquartered. A local business license is mandatory for operation.

Step 5: Register for Taxes

Register with the Federal Revenue Service to obtain tax ID numbers and fulfill corporate tax obligations.

Step 6: Apply for Industry-Specific Licenses (If Applicable)

Depending on the industry (e.g., food, health), obtain additional permits from relevant authorities like the Ministry of Health.

Documents Required for Company Registration in Brazil

The following documents are generally required for company incorporation in Brazil:

  • Articles of Incorporation
  • CNPJ Registration Form
  • Passports or IDs of shareholders and directors.
  • Business License Application
  • Tax Registration Form
  • Proof of Address (Lease agreement or utility bill of registered address)
  • Industry Licenses/Permits (if applicable)
  • Bank Statement or Proof of Funds

Types of Business Entities in Brazil

Choosing the right legal structure is a critical decision for your Brazil business registration.

Here are the main types:

1. Limited Liability Company (LTDA)

  • limited liability company in Brazil is the most common type of company in Brazil.
  • Requires a minimum of one and a maximum of 20 shareholders.
  • Shareholders are liable only up to the amount of their capital contribution.
  • Flexible structure suitable for both small and medium-sized businesses.

2. Corporation (S.A. – Sociedade Anônima)

  • Best suited for large-scale businesses or those planning to raise capital through the stock market.
  • Requires a board of directors and regular shareholder meetings.
  • Minimum share capital of R$1,000,000.
  • Can be either publicly or privately held.

3. Individual Microentrepreneur (MEI)

  • Designed for solo entrepreneurs with annual revenues under a specific threshold (currently around BRL 81,000).
  • Simplified tax regime and lower compliance requirements.
  • Personal liability applies, but is widely used for low-risk businesses.

4. Branch Office

  • An extension of a foreign company with operations in Brazil.
  • Must appoint a legal representative who resides in Brazil.
  • Subject to the same taxation and regulatory obligations as local entities.

5. Joint Venture

  • A contractual or corporate arrangement between two or more parties.
  • Common in large infrastructure, oil & gas, and technology projects.
  • Enables foreign companies to partner with local businesses for strategic growth.

Still unsure about which type suits your needs? Our team at OnDemand International can help you choose the best structure tailored to your business model and goals.

Taxes Applicable to Companies in Brazil

Businesses in Brazil are subject to the following taxes:

  • Corporate Income Tax (IRPJ): 15% on net income
  • Social Contribution on Net Profit (CSLL): 9%
  • Value Added Tax (ICMS): 18% average, varies by state
  • Payroll Tax (INSS): 20% on salaries
  • Property Tax (IPTU): Municipal level, varies
  • Social Security Tax (FGTS): 8% on salaries

Cost of Registering a Company in Brazil

Company registration costs can vary based on business type, location, and industry. Generally, expenses include:

  • Legal Fees: Paid to attorneys/accountants for document preparation
  • Government Fees: Registration, licensing, and tax applications
  • Share Capital: Deposited to company bank account (varies by structure)
  • Notary Fees: For notarizing documents

Advantages of Company Registration in Brazil

1. Access to a Massive Consumer Market

With over 214 million consumers, Brazil is the largest economy in Latin America. Companies have access to a diverse population and a growing middle class with increasing purchasing power.

2. Gateway to South American Markets

Brazil is a founding member of Mercosur, a trading bloc that facilitates tariff-free access to neighboring countries like Argentina, Paraguay, and Uruguay.

3. Government Support for Foreign Investment

Brazil offers incentives such as tax exemptions, reduced import tariffs, and simplified licensing processes for foreign companies in priority sectors.

4. Resource-Rich Economy

Brazil boasts abundant natural resources—including oil, iron ore, and agricultural goods—making it a hotspot for manufacturing, agribusiness, and energy sectors.

5. Strategic Geographical Location

Its location between the Atlantic Ocean and neighboring economies allows companies to connect trade routes between North America, Europe, and the rest of Latin America.

6. Robust Legal and Financial Infrastructure

Brazil’s legal system is rooted in civil law and provides a stable environment for commercial operations. Its financial institutions are modern and globally integrated.

7. Opportunities Across Diverse Sectors

From fintech and logistics to agritech and e-commerce, Brazil’s economy is growing in both traditional and tech-driven industries, making it ideal for startups and MNCs alike.

Also Read: Reasons to incorporate a business in Brazil

Conclusion

Registering a company in Brazil opens doors to one of Latin America’s largest and most dynamic economies. Though the process can be complex and time-consuming, the rewards in terms of market access, growth potential, and government incentives are significant.

To simplify the process and ensure compliance, it’s recommended to engage professionals. Contact OnDemand International today and let our expert team assist you through every step of your Brazil company registration journey.

FAQ’s

Yes, foreign individuals and entities can own 100% of a Brazilian company. However, a legal representative residing in Brazil must be appointed.

An LTDA is simpler and suitable for small to medium-sized businesses, whereas an S.A. is more complex, ideal for large corporations and those planning to go public.

No, the process can be completed remotely via a Power of Attorney. However, having local representation is essential.

It typically takes 4–8 weeks, depending on the entity type, documentation, and the state in which the business is registered.

Companies must comply with accounting, tax reporting, labor laws, and annual filings. Many companies appoint local accountants for these purposes.

Yes, once the company is registered and you have a CNPJ, you can open a corporate bank account. Some banks may require in-person verification.